Here is what I gathered from my dealer - apparently they are finally doing something to be more aware:

1. On 7/16, Dealership showed my FE was still 19'd. The following Tuesday, 7/20, they informed me it had changed to 01.
So check with your dealer, ask for a new DORA sheet. Check to see if yours changed.
If it's anything <10, yours is in the chute so to speak as only Ford can set your priority to single digits. Dealers can only set to 10 or higher.

2. Scheduling week is not build week. MAP is shut down, and may have extra shutdown weeks depending on chip/top issues causing many to be parked until those parts come in. You can't build more if you have no space to put them, and what space they are using, some of it has a rental cost.

3. Semiconductors are slowly becoming available - news the PC world is that newer chips there are starting to ship again. I figure automotive can't be far behind. I have no insight into Ford's supply chain directly though, so I have no idea of their delays.

4. As noted elsewhere, First Editions were not limited by dealership allocation. My dealership told me the same thing.

5. "First Edition" was probably not the best moniker to use. Most of us associate "First Edition" with publishing and being the 'first' produced like it means in the publishing industry. Here is how my dealership explained it: "A Ford selected set of options combined into a trim package for the first production year. These will be produced alongside other trim levels." Nowhere in that definition does it suggest it will be first produced of all models that year, just a trim package that is custom for the first year. This definition also fits how it's being used on the Maverick. Maybe if Ford communicated it that way, it would have been more clear. Its what I based my understanding on, and why I am not frustrated. I knew it was potentially going to be a long wait.

6. If you ordered a First Edition trim, check with your dealer ASAP to make sure it's buildable. I hear some orders are still configured for dual tops or the MOD top resulting in unbuildable configurations. These options are no longer available and that needs to be changed at the dealership. The dealership "owns" the order entry process, so they have to be the ones who change it. You can't call the helpline and have them change it, and Ford will not proactively change it. YOU have to go in and request it. And be sure to get an updated DORA sheet when you do it. I would suggest getting this done today if possible. Your priority code may not change right away. It will wait for the next preview pass to get updated.

To expand on this: I was told buildable First Editions were changed to Priority 01 or 02. If yours was NOT changed, you need to make sure it's buildable now. The way it was explained to me through other channels closer to Ford: All buildable First Editions were all switched to 01 or 02. Priority 01s will get scheduled next. If there are available slots left on the schedule and it won't affect building 01s, then 02s will fill in those slots. Any 02s that do not make the cut this round will be bumped to 01 for the next round of scheduling. If yours is NOT changed to buildable before that next round, you're SOL because they switch to MY22 scheduling after that. So please, please, please - check with your dealership, make sure yours is buildable NOW, otherwise you may not get it at all as it cannot make MY21 scheduling if you don't.


7. The models/posters/bags/points thing - most I saw with the models had serious scheduling issues, and those with posters had some less serious scheduling issues, so it seems to be a 'peace offering' based on the level of disappointment. I have not received ANYTHING from Ford or my local dealership (in fact, it went the other way around LOL I gave the sales tower guy a Maisto Wildtrak Bronco model in red LOL), but that's probably because mine was never scheduled and changed. My only thing was the tops, so I changed it and even told those points will arrive a few weeks after I take delivery on top of the 42000 from the purchase. The bags and other stuff is dealership dependent - the dealership is buying that swag themselves to give out, and some dealerships aren't buying swag.

You aren't alone. Reserved FE within first hour of website going live during premiere. Placed configuration as soon as possible in January for FE in LB and Onyx Black Interior. I have received zero communication from dealer or FORD except for poster. Although on Wednesday of last week I logged into Ford.com and the reservation now says "Ordering with Dealer".

Read the forum this morning and called dealer. They said that FE's are being given priority for MIC tops and they had just delivered their first Bronco on Friday which was a soft top. They said they have over 40 Bronco's in the same situation as me and I was near the front of the line. I didn't clarify with them if that was 40 FE's or total Broncos.

Anyhow, just wanted to let you know you aren't alone. They said I have no build date, no vin, no window sticker and the local dealership has not been contacted by the factory yet despite the reservation status changing.
